Steps to know the … Web13 mrt. 2024 · If your computer uses an integrated GPU, then the GPU doesn’t have any RAM of its own. Instead, a portion of your system RAM is reserved to act as video memory. However, the needs of a CPU and a GPU are a little different when it comes to bandwidth, latency, and speed. Web29 feb. 2016 · The amount displayed in GTA V is really just a way of the game estimating the overall demand based upon settings. Its not a limit by any means, rather reflects how high you set certain options. If the game is lagging as you say, it has nothing to do with the memory used displayed. GPU rendering makes it possible to use your graphics card for rendering, instead of the CPU. This can speed up rendering because modern GPUs are designed to do quite a lot of number crunching.
